Understanding Industrial Plastic Curtains


Industrial plastic curtains, typically made from durable and flexible PVC (polyvinyl chloride), are designed to separate different areas within a facility. They are commonly used in warehouses, manufacturing plants, food processing facilities, and cold storage areas. The curtains can be hung from ceilings or frames, providing a versatile solution that can be easily adjusted or moved according to the specific needs of a workspace.


Benefits of Using Industrial Plastic Curtains


1. Controlling Environment One of the primary advantages of industrial plastic curtains is their ability to control the environment within a workspace. By minimizing the transfer of air, dust, and debris between different areas, these curtains help maintain cleanliness and reduce contamination. This is especially critical in industries like food processing and pharmaceuticals, where hygiene standards are stringent.


2. Temperature Regulation In facilities dealing with temperature-sensitive products, such as refrigerated goods or chemical processes, maintaining an optimal environment is crucial. Industrial plastic curtains act as thermal barriers, helping to retain cold or heat within specific zones. This not only saves energy but also ensures that products are kept at the required temperatures, thereby preserving their quality and safety.

3. Noise Reduction Industrial settings can be noisy, which can lead to a decrease in worker productivity and increased health risks due to prolonged exposure to loud environments. Plastic curtains can help dampen sound, creating a more conducive working atmosphere that enhances focus and reduces fatigue.


4. Safety and Security Safety is a top priority in any industrial operation. Plastic curtains can serve as barriers to prevent unauthorized access to specific areas while also allowing for easy visibility. This transparency is vital for monitoring operations while ensuring that safety protocols are upheld. Further, in environments where heavy machinery is used, these curtains can offer a degree of protection from flying debris or hazardous materials.


5. Cost-Effectiveness Compared to permanent walls or partitions, industrial plastic curtains are a more cost-effective solution. They are often less expensive to install, and their flexibility means that they can be easily reconfigured as business needs change. This adaptability is particularly beneficial for companies looking to optimize their workflows without incurring significant construction costs.


Applications Across Industries


Industrial plastic curtains have versatile applications across various sectors. In food processing plants, they can help segregate raw materials from finished products, reducing the risk of cross-contamination. In automotive manufacturing, these curtains can be used in paint booths to contain overspray and improve air quality. Similarly, in warehouses, they can provide easy access to loading docks while maintaining a barrier against weather conditions.
